Ok, I'll spill the beans. Over the last year, my sliders have migrated upward. Yes I welded them on correclty.
So I came up with these "shock absorbing" legs on the way to Moab last October. Finally got a design I liked and was simple. Basically your truck has a suspension to absorb blows, so will my sliders to absorb blows. We'll see how it goes.
I upraded the legs from 1/8" wall to 3/16" wall as well. 1/8" is for center consoles. Just ask Cheese.
I'll probably re-install the sliders tomorrow. This will NEVER be a product as the amount of time to build these is absurd, but when it's for me, it's free.
